Kirchgasse

Kirchgasse is a long, power-hike climb above Birgitz in Tirol. Its 9.0 TEP puts it above 76% of catalogued climbs. Expect 51 to 86 minutes. Its steepest 500 metres run at 20.1% and start 3.9 km in, so the worst of it lands when you are already committed. On the SAC scale it is mountain hiking, with uneven ground that asks for some care. North-facing, so it holds shade and snow longer than the sunny side of the valley. It features in 4 race courses, including K110 Master of Innsbruck.
